Transaction 101d136d379290eccf808a562552fac638c1c0399677b76c765d2c5d9fa66196

1 Input
2 Outputs
  • 101d136d379290eccf808a562552fac638c1c0399677b76c765d2c5d9fa66196:0
  • value  143064
    address  1QHnStMkfoEEyZeEQ6XBCW4fxHuZ8bhS5S
  • 101d136d379290eccf808a562552fac638c1c0399677b76c765d2c5d9fa66196:1
  • value  18631
    address  3A1kobD9exbfWfZ1jC6JdZZXRhCke5K4wT